Charts are randomly blank in Nprinting May 2023

Dear Qlik Support Team,

After upgrading to the last version of Qlikview and Nprinting (May 2023), we noticed that charts set to be displayed as images in Excel reports are randomly blank.

See screenshots below: same report template with different renders.

In the Designer, images appear correctly in preview mode.

What we tried so far with no success : open/save the report and update the metadata

Any idea what happens ?

Hi @cedric_loch ,

The issue is related to QlikView and QlikView May 2023 SR1 is available for download and its Release Notes are at https://community.qlik.com/t5/Release-Notes/QlikView-May-2023-SR1/ta-p/2123328 with a mention of this issue.

Hi @Ruggero_Piccoli ,

The release notes mentions the issue as a 'known issue', meaning it is not fixed: "QV-24977: Because of a critical issue with chart rendering in NPrinting reports we had to revert the fix".

Is the issue still being investigated ?
